Rates and thresholds
The expressions above read these as $const. They are the figures the annual refresh replaces, so they live as data rather than being written into the formulas — which is what makes a year-on-year change a one-line diff instead of an edit to arithmetic.
| Constant | Value |
|---|---|
day1 | 8.1 |
day10 | 10.8 |
day30 | 17.1 |
annualVignette | 90 |
